Vita: Where are all the Sports Games?

2013 looks to be a lean year for Playstation Vita Owners. No NCAA football. No professional wrestling. No NBA. No NHL. What reason do owners of the handheld who enjoy their sports games have to own the system? While MLB 12 The Show: Vita is arguably one of the best handheld sports titles of all time, Madden 13 and FIFA 13 left plenty to be desired. Rather than build off the success of the console game, Madden 13 on the Vita relied on too many of the systems bells and whistles. Jukes and spins on the back touch screen?

Not going to work.
